Please make an appointment prior to visiting.","Betty Lou Ramsey (February 23, 1929 - July 19, 2014) was born in Barbour County, West Virginia, to parents Beatrice Wilson and Willie Ray Ramsey. She had one sister, Effie Lucille Ramsey (1921-2006). Ms. Ramsey graduated from Belington High School and attended West Virginia University, earning her bachelor's degree in 1951. Then she began teaching at Buckhannon Upshur High School and served as a Critic Teacher at West Virginia Wesleyan College. She then earned a graduate degree from University of Tennessee and returned to WVU to teach in 1955 or 1956. In the early 1960s, she was asked to develop an Interior Design Program and Studio in the College of Human Resources (that program was later transitioned to the Davis College of Agriculture, Natural Resources, and Design). She retired in 1985. Later in life, she became interested in gardening and genealogy. She was a member of the James Barbour Chapter of the DAR and Clan Ramsey Association of North America.","4246, 5201","Personal and professional papers of Betty Lou Ramsey (1929-2014), Professor Emerita and founder of the Interior Design Program at West Virginia University. These items could have been created by the theatre department, or they could be vintage items with some tailoring by the department.  They were likely prepared for productions in the period 1960-1980; the styles of the items date to ca. 1900-1960.  There are 4 dresses, 3 jackets, 5 shirtwaist pieces, 1 undergarment, 1 night gown, and 1 long skirt.\u003c/p\u003e"],"scopecontent_heading_ssm":["Scope and Contents"],"scopecontent_tesim":["Fifteen garments from the School of Theatre and Dance.  These items could have been created by the theatre department, or they could be vintage items with some tailoring by the department.  They were likely prepared for productions in the period 1960-1980; the styles of the items date to ca. 1900-1960.  There are 4 dresses, 3 jackets, 5 shirtwaist pieces, 1 undergarment, 1 night gown, and 1 long skirt."],"userestrict_html_tesm":["\u003cp\u003ePermission to publish or reproduce is required from the copyright holder.
